Unlike the futures or options markets, you can actually start trading with as low as $100 in the forex market. Forex is a leveraged market, which means you can use a little money to trade up to 20 or 30 times the amount you will be required to stake in a trade (UK and europe), and sometimes even as much as 500 times your required investment amount (known as the margin). This makes the idea of trading forex quite interesting to many. However, trading with $100 in the forex market, even if you have access to a leverage of as high as 1:500, comes with its own set of challenges and rules. This is what this article is all about.


What can’t you do with $100 in your forex account?


Here are some things a $100 forex account cannot do for you.



  1. It will not enable you to quit your job to start trading full-time. There are countries on this earth where $100 is the equivalent of one day’s rent. It is simply impossible to make $100 a day from $100 capital to survive in such places. Of course, other personal and household bills have not been added to the mix yet.

  2. You will not become the next warren buffett or george soros overnight. You cannot start trading with $100 and expect to start rubbing shoulders with these guys in terms of monthly earnings from trading.

  3. You will not grow to $10,000 or $100,000 in a month. We have been seeing such ads coming from advertisers of forex robots and other affiliated software. We also see such ads in the binary options market, as many traders were told that they could achieve this using the short term expiry trades. Forget it: it will not happen.

How to start forex trading with $100


These days, the process of opening and funding a forex account has been made very easy. You can do this in a matter of minutes using any of the payment methods available from the broker. After funding your account, you can then trade forex with $100 following these rules.


Rule 1: money management


The first method is to trade with money management as the number 1 focus. This money management-focused method means that you will trade with no more than 3% of this money in total market exposure. This means you can only trade micro-lots ($1000 minimum position size). If you hold an account with a UK or EU broker, you can only use a maximum leverage of 1:30. With a margin of 3.33%, this means that you cannot trade within the boundaries of risk management with an EU broker, as you will need at least $33 to trade 1 micro-lot. However, a brokerage in australia, south africa or any of the other popular offshore jurisdictions still offer leverage of up to 1:500. A micro-lot would therefore need just $2 commitment from the trader, which keeps the position within allowable risk management limits.


Rule 2: risk-reward ratios


The next rule has to do with risk and reward. Risk refers to the stop loss (SL) you will use, and reward has to do with the take profit (TP) setting. You should target to make 3 pips in profit for any 1 pip risked as stop loss. Using your allowable money management that restricts you to 1 micro-lot positions, this means that you should be prepared to target $6 for every $2 used in the stop loss. This translates to at least 60 pips TP, and 20 pips SL.


This means that you have to be super-selective of your trades. Only enter into trades where there is a high chance of winning, and use well-defined parameters of support and resistance to target your setups. Fortunately, some chart patterns such as the flag and pennant have standardized profit targets, and the pattern boundaries can also help define the stop loss.


Rule 3: avoid the news spikes


News trades are highly unpredictable, especially within the first few minutes of a news release. The spikes and whipsaws can easily stop your trades out. With such limited capital, you should avoid news trades like a plague.


Ultimately, you will need to work on getting more capital, but by the time you do, your $100 journey in forex trading would have prepared you adequately to trade larger capital responsibly.

What is a small forex account?


Alright, so before we get into the advice about growing a small forex account, it would probably be helpful to define what a small account is. Now, for the purposes of today’s article, we would say that any account with a balance under $1,000 is a small account. Realistically, when it comes to the volume at which professional traders trade at, anything under $10,000 could be considered a small account.


However, there are plenty of people out there who just don’t have that kind of capital to start with. Therefore, we are going to focus on growing a small forex account, one that starts at around $1,000 or less. Yes people, starting with so little cash for trading is a challenge, but there are steps you can take to increase your chances of growing that small forex account into something substantial.


Small accounts vs large accounts


Now, you might be wondering why we are talking about growing a small forex account, especially in terms of why it can be so difficult. Well, the reason why we are covering this specifically is because you have much more leeway when trading with a large account. For one, when you have a lot of money to trade FX with, you have a lot more options to work with.


Moreover, when you are trading with a large account balance, all of that cash serves as a buffer. For instance, if you lose $250 in a trade, but your overall account balance is $100,000, then that $250 is no big deal. However, if you lose $250, and you only had $500 to start with, then the overall impact is much more severe. Simply put, when you have little money for trading, every dollar counts, and even a single loss can spell doom.


Growing A small forex account – essential advice


Right now, let’s go over some of the most crucial advice which you much follow if you hope to have any success when growing a small forex account.


1% risk rule


One thing which you must always do as a trader looking to grow a small forex account is to stick to the 1% risk rule. This means that on any single one trade, you should never be risking more than 1% of your total account balance. So, if you have $1,000 to begin with, you should not be risking more than $10 per trade.


Now, if your trading account is exceedingly small, and there is a fairly large minimum trade amount you must invest per trade, you might have to push it by a couple of percent. However, that said, you never want to risk a high percentage of your account balance for a single trade.


Leveraging trades


Ok, something that can come in handy when growing a small forex account is to leverage your trades. If you leverage a trade, it means that you can trade with much more capital than you actually have at your disposal. In other words, you can leverage a trade, for example, by 10:1, which means that the trade you place might be for $100, but you only have to put up one tenth of that amount up front, so $10.


This can be very useful if you want to trade with more capital than you have liquid at your disposal. However, do also keep in mind that this can be dangerous too. If the trade turns out to be a loser, going back to our previous example, you will be on the hook for the full $100, not just for the $10.


Stop loss & take profit


Something else you should always do when growing a small forex account is to utilize stop loss and take profit levels according to your situation. Some people may set stop loss levels at well under half the initial investment. However, if you have such a small trading account, can you afford to lose even half the initial investment from a trade? Probably not.


Therefore, it’s a good idea to set your stop loss level b between 80% and 90%. In other words, if a trade goes south, at least you will only lose between 10% and 20% of the initial investment, but you’ll be able to save the rest.


In terms of take profit levels, some people get really greedy and hope to double their money. Well, as somebody with a small account, you need to take every single dollar of profit that you can get. Waiting and waiting for profits to keep increasing is not a good idea. If you have made a 10% profit, or even less, on a single trade, walk away with it. A small profit is always better than any kind of loss.

Should you trade forex with $100?


Too many people believe that trading in the foreign exchange market requires you to start with a considerable initial amount of money at your disposal or to be already pretty wealthy.


Well, to trade forex, you should be financially stable and able to lose. Experts claim that any money you invest in forex trading should be disposable ; in other words, financial losses shouldn’t affect your daily life.


If you are new to the forex market, in particular, you can expect at least a dozen sources to bombard you with recommendations and suggestions on how to get rich trading forex and build considerable forex wealth at a rapid pace and with a low amount of money.


One of the most popular and controversial theories in the field of forex trading suggests that you can initially invest just $100 in entering the forex market, which can quickly grow to as much as $10,000 or even a million in a short period of time. Whether or not forex beginners can stand a chance of a great return is a subject of an endless list of factors. But it’s unlikely.


How to trade forex with $100


Although many people believe that a large amount of money at your disposal is much needed for starting trading forex, there are also many forex beginners coming into the forex market with relatively small trading accounts of just $100, £100 or similar amounts.


Here we should note that there are different forex trading accounts you can consider. Forex brokers often offer four types: standard, mini, micro, and nano accounts. While standard accounts require initial capital, mini accounts allow people to trade forex using mini lots.


However, one of the main fundamentals in the foreign exchange market is that the size of your account is not the most important thing in this initial stage.


Learning is what matters the most in order to benefit from the potential chance to earn money by trading forex. Hands down, you will soon find out that it is easier said than done as it takes a lot of patience and discipline to be able to witness the progress of your account.


If you’re looking for some great options for a forex trading education, make sure you check out trading education’s free forex trading course . With the right educational background and a lot of practice, you will be able to learn the art of forex trading.


On top of that, to trade forex, one should be consistent . Never trade forex out of greed or revenge! Discipline, patience, and emotional control, along with other characteristics and skills valued in the forex realm, are just a few of the fundaments that you should master.

2. Understand leverage in forex


Here we should mention that one of the main factors which attracts traders to forex trading is high leverage. That said, the primary reason why so many people fail and leave the forex market is high leverage, too.


Normally, a minimum of 50:1 leverage ratio is what the majority of all the reliable brokers out there offer . Though leverage in forex can be limited and controlled by government regulations, in some countries forex brokers may offer you a leverage ratio of 500:1 or even 1000:1!


Though all this sounds like a good way to make some quick money, be aware that the higher the leverage, the higher the possibility of losing money. So you may want to keep the risk and the leverage low.

How to manage a small forex trading account?


The basic principles of managing a small and a large forex account are all the same.


However, when you manage a small account you will be obviously trading smaller position sizes per trade, which can lead to dissatisfaction and impatience. In this case, keep greed and emotions out of the equation and avoid over-leveraging and trading too large. This is a common mistake many forex trading beginners tend to make, which can destroy your account faster than you can spell your name.


Focus on trading only the most obvious and confluent price action setups, adopt a more relaxed forex trading style, don’t be aggressive. This will help you manage your money and increase your chances of making a profit.


Also, every time you enter a trade, make sure that you are prepared to lose as you could potentially lose any forex trade. After all, there is a theoretical pattern of loss and gain in life, and forex trading is no exception.

Why starting with $100 is A smart choice?


The answer is easy: risk management reasons. Before you place an order, it would be smart to stick to risk management rules. Experienced traders don’t risk more than 1% of their accounts. And that’s how they don’t lose a lot of money.


So, if you begin with $100, then your risk should be $1. Some people might say that $1 won’t help you make money, but you always have to keep your interest!


Imagine what will happen if your risk is $100, and your investment choice was terrible. How will you be able to make $10,000 if you have $0 in your account?
